XPages错误消息:无效的持久内容会话id:

XPages错误消息:无效的持久内容会话id:,xpages,Xpages,我们有一个使用XPages构建的文档管理应用程序,运行在Domino 9.0.1服务器上,我们最近经常遇到这样的错误: Invalid persisted content session id: . 有人知道这是从哪里来的吗?可能的原因?可能导致此问题的服务器或应用程序设置 我在谷歌上搜索了一下,什么也没找到。。。没有一个结果 以下是堆栈跟踪: Page Name: /page.xsp java.lang.IllegalArgumentException: Invalid persisted

我们有一个使用XPages构建的文档管理应用程序,运行在Domino 9.0.1服务器上,我们最近经常遇到这样的错误:

Invalid persisted content session id: .
有人知道这是从哪里来的吗?可能的原因?可能导致此问题的服务器或应用程序设置

我在谷歌上搜索了一下,什么也没找到。。。没有一个结果

以下是堆栈跟踪:

Page Name: /page.xsp
java.lang.IllegalArgumentException: Invalid persisted content session id: .
    at com.ibm.xsp.persistence.AbstractPersistedContent.(AbstractPersistedContent.java:42)
    at com.ibm.xsp.persistence.FilePersistedContent.(FilePersistedContent.java:46)
    at com.ibm.xsp.persistence.FilePersistenceService.createPersistedContent(FilePersistenceService.java:73)
    at com.ibm.xsp.model.domino.wrapped.DominoRichTextItem.getPersistedContent(DominoRichTextItem.java:3086)
    at com.ibm.xsp.model.domino.wrapped.DominoRichTextItem.extractCID(DominoRichTextItem.java:1393)
    at com.ibm.xsp.model.domino.wrapped.DominoRichTextItem.extractMimeText(DominoRichTextItem.java:1341)
    at com.ibm.xsp.model.domino.wrapped.DominoRichTextItem.getRichTextMime(DominoRichTextItem.java:1280)
    at com.ibm.xsp.model.domino.wrapped.DominoRichTextItem.getHTML(DominoRichTextItem.java:392)
    at com.ibm.xsp.model.domino.wrapped.DominoRichTextItem.toString(DominoRichTextItem.java:378)
    at com.ibm.xsp.util.FacesUtil.convertValue(FacesUtil.java:1146)
    at com.ibm.xsp.renderkit.html_basic.ReadOnlyRteRenderer.encodeText(ReadOnlyRteRenderer.java:86)
    at com.ibm.xsp.renderkit.html_basic.ReadOnlyRteRenderer.encodeValue(ReadOnlyRteRenderer.java:50)
    at com.ibm.xsp.renderkit.html_basic.ReadOnlyValueRenderer.encodeBegin(ReadOnlyValueRenderer.java:69)
    at com.ibm.xsp.renderkit.ReadOnlyAdapterRenderer.encodeBegin(ReadOnlyAdapterRenderer.java:146)
    at com.ibm.xsp.renderkit.ReadOnlyAdapterRenderer.encodeBegin(ReadOnlyAdapterRenderer.java:146)
    at javax.faces.component.UIComponentBase.encodeBegin(UIComponentBase.java:956)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:842)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.extlib.renderkit.html_extended.layout.AbstractApplicationLayoutRenderer.renderChildren(AbstractApplicationLayoutRenderer.java:1401)
    at com.ibm.xsp.extlib.renderkit.html_extended.layout.AbstractApplicationLayoutRenderer.writeContentColumn(AbstractApplicationLayoutRenderer.java:1203)
    at com.ibm.xsp.extlib.renderkit.html_extended.layout.AbstractApplicationLayoutRenderer.writeMainContent(AbstractApplicationLayoutRenderer.java:1105)
    at com.ibm.xsp.extlib.renderkit.html_extended.layout.AbstractApplicationLayoutRenderer.writeMainFrame(AbstractApplicationLayoutRenderer.java:237)
    at com.ibm.xsp.extlib.renderkit.html_extended.layout.AbstractApplicationLayoutRenderer.encodeBegin(AbstractApplicationLayoutRenderer.java:1367)
    at com.ibm.xsp.renderkit.ReadOnlyAdapterRenderer.encodeBegin(ReadOnlyAdapterRenderer.java:146)
    at javax.faces.component.UIComponentBase.encodeBegin(UIComponentBase.java:956)
    at com.ibm.xsp.extlib.component.layout.UIVarPublisherBase.encodeBegin(UIVarPublisherBase.java:112)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:842)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.util.FacesUtil.renderComponent(FacesUtil.java:853)
    at com.ibm.xsp.component.UIViewRootEx._renderView(UIViewRootEx.java:1317)
    at com.ibm.xsp.component.UIViewRootEx.renderView(UIViewRootEx.java:1255)
    at com.ibm.xsp.application.ViewHandlerExImpl.doRender(ViewHandlerExImpl.java:651)
    at com.ibm.xsp.application.ViewHandlerExImpl._renderView(ViewHandlerExImpl.java:321)
    at com.ibm.xsp.application.ViewHandlerExImpl.renderView(ViewHandlerExImpl.java:336)
    at com.sun.faces.lifecycle.RenderResponsePhase.execute(RenderResponsePhase.java:103)
    at com.sun.faces.lifecycle.LifecycleImpl.phase(LifecycleImpl.java:210)
    at com.sun.faces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:120)
    at com.ibm.xsp.controller.FacesControllerImpl.render(FacesControllerImpl.java:270)
    at com.ibm.xsp.webapp.FacesServlet.serviceView(FacesServlet.java:261)
    at com.ibm.xsp.webapp.FacesServletEx.serviceView(FacesServletEx.java:157)
    at com.ibm.xsp.webapp.FacesServlet.service(FacesServlet.java:160)
    at com.ibm.xsp.webapp.FacesServletEx.service(FacesServletEx.java:138)
    at com.ibm.xsp.webapp.DesignerFacesServlet.service(DesignerFacesServlet.java:103)
    at com.ibm.designer.runtime.domino.adapter.ComponentModule.invokeServlet(ComponentModule.java:576)
    at com.ibm.domino.xsp.module.nsf.NSFComponentModule.invokeServlet(NSFComponentModule.java:1335)
    at com.ibm.designer.runtime.domino.adapter.ComponentModule$AdapterInvoker.invokeServlet(ComponentModule.java:853)
    at com.ibm.designer.runtime.domino.adapter.ComponentModule$ServletInvoker.doService(ComponentModule.java:796)
    at com.ibm.designer.runtime.domino.adapter.ComponentModule.doService(ComponentModule.java:565)
    at com.ibm.domino.xsp.module.nsf.NSFComponentModule.doService(NSFComponentModule.java:1319)
    at com.ibm.domino.xsp.module.nsf.NSFService.doServiceInternal(NSFService.java:662)
    at com.ibm.domino.xsp.module.nsf.NSFService.doService(NSFService.java:482)
    at com.ibm.designer.runtime.domino.adapter.LCDEnvironment.doService(LCDEnvironment.java:357)
    at com.ibm.designer.runtime.domino.adapter.LCDEnvironment.service(LCDEnvironment.java:313)
    at com.ibm.domino.xsp.bridge.http.engine.XspCmdManager.service(XspCmdManager.java:272)

有痕迹吗?这是从哪里来的,Domino控制台?Xpages前端消息或错误页?您可以检查ibm_technical_support文件夹中的stacktraces日志。此错误来自文件持久性服务(用于处理CKEditor的附件)。由于没有可用的会话id,因此引发错误。可能是爬虫程序试图直接访问某些附件?在原始帖子中添加了堆栈跟踪…那么这是否意味着试图访问使用src(例如)构建的图像会产生此错误,因为该文件不再存在???@BenDubuc:是的,这可能会导致错误。有堆栈跟踪吗?这是从哪里来的,Domino控制台?Xpages前端消息或错误页?您可以检查ibm_technical_support文件夹中的stacktraces日志。此错误来自文件持久性服务(用于处理CKEditor的附件)。由于没有可用的会话id,因此引发错误。可能是爬虫程序试图直接访问某些附件?在原始帖子中添加了堆栈跟踪…那么这是否意味着试图访问使用src(例如)构建的图像会产生此错误,因为该文件不再存在???@BenDubuc:是的,这可能会导致错误。